zoukankan      html  css  js  c++  java
  • 用户注册时在输入账号的时候如果已存在该账户则出现提示信息

    // 当注册账户已存在
            $('.login-form').find('.address-email').on('input', function () {
                var $this = $(this),
                    email = $.trim($this.val()),
                    pattern = /w+([-+.']w+)*@w+([-.]w+)*.w+([-.]w+)*/,
                    ajaxRegisterEmail,
                    recognised = $this.next('.recognised'),
                    submitBtn = $this.parent().siblings('.buttons').find('.btn-submit');
    
                if (ajaxRegisterEmail !== undefined) {
                    ajaxRegisterEmail.abort();
                }
    
                if (email !== '' && pattern.test(email)) {
                    ajaxRegisterEmail = $.ajax({
                        url: eventure.getUncachedUrl('/Base/BaseHandler'),
                        type: 'POST',
                        data: {
                            pt: 'check-email-exist',
                            email: email
                        },
                        success: function (data) {
                            if (data.status === 'f') {
                                recognised.show().text(data.message);
                                $this.addClass('input-validation-error');
                                submitBtn.addClass('disabled').removeClass('btn-red').prop('disabled', true);
                            } else {
                                recognised.hide();
                                $this.removeClass('input-validation-error');
                                submitBtn.removeClass('disabled').addClass('btn-red').prop('disabled', false);
                            }
                        }
                    })
                }
    
            });
    

      

  • 相关阅读:
    币值转换
    抓老鼠啊~亏了还是赚了?
    第十二周作业
    第十一周作业
    第十周作业
    第九周作业
    第八周作业
    第七周作业
    第五周实验报告和总结
    第四次实验报告及总结
  • 原文地址:https://www.cnblogs.com/gfl123/p/8575153.html
Copyright © 2011-2022 走看看